Lairi (Luri), Jatinga Valley
Lairi (Luri) is a village located in the Haflong Subdivision of Dima Hasao district of Assam. The village falls in Jatinga Valley block.
As on May 2024, the current population of Lairi (Luri) is 569 out of which 292 are males and rest 277 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 949 females per 1000 males. There are around 78 teenagers in Lairi (Luri). It has literacy rate of 77% which means around 439 persons can read and write. Total 0 people belonging to scheduled caste and 569 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 72 households in Lairi (Luri), which means every family has 8 members on average. The village has working population of 199. The pincode of Lairi (Luri) is 788108 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
